Add image generation (#2)

* Add image generation

* Optimise for minimal memory

* Added a new ui

* Add support for esp
This commit was merged in pull request #2.
This commit is contained in:
2025-07-19 19:11:31 +02:00
committed by GitHub
parent e9d145455e
commit e21601234a
25 changed files with 1188 additions and 31 deletions

View File

@@ -0,0 +1,12 @@
namespace HomeApi.Models;
public class MicroProcessorConfiguration
{
public string InformationBoardImageUrl { get; set; } = string.Empty;
public int UpdateIntervalMinutes { get; set; } = 2;
public int BlackTextThreshold { get; set; } = 190; // (0-255)
public bool EnableDithering { get; set; } = true;
public int DitheringStrength { get; set; } = 8; // (8-32)
public bool EnhanceContrast { get; set; } = true;
public int ContrastStrength { get; set; } = 10; // (0-100)
}